WebThe Chomper's main power is eat a zombie whole, but takes a lot to chew. If Plant Food is given to it, Chomper will chew (If it's chewing), eat all zombies on its line, chew it and burp it affecting the entire line. WebHe is one of the two Chompers to shoot a projectile as its normal attack. The other is Yeti Chomper . Unlike the Yeti Chomper, Assistant Manager Bitey's projectile flies straight instead of lobbed. He is the only plant in Garden Warfare 2 capable of double-jumping. This Chomper can eat zombies from behind, but no sound will be played.
